A-ha's Morten Harket talks 'Take on Me': 'It did a lot of good stuff, but also did some damage'
Anyone of a certain age — or anyone who's heard of MTV, period — is familiar with the iconic 1984 synthpop hit “Take on Me” by Norwegian band A-ha. Recently reborn in a raw, stripped-down version, it's become an internet sensation.

'Take On Me' singers A-ha reunite with new album
Norwegian band A-ha, whose "Take On Me" track remains one of the most popular songs from the 1980s, are reuniting temporarily, releasing their first new material in six years. The band split after a worldwide tour in 2010 and vocalist Morten Harket, keyboardist Magne Furuholmen and guitarist Paul Waaktaar-Savoy went on to pursue solo projects.
